What Are Overnight Anti-Wrinkle Eye Patches?

Overnight anti-wrinkle eye patches are small, adhesive strips or gel-based pads designed to be worn under the eyes while you sleep. Infused with active ingredients like hyaluronic acid, retinol, peptides, or collagen, they target common concerns such as crow’s feet, under-eye bags, and dark circles. The idea is simple: apply the patches before bed, let them work their magic for six to eight hours, and wake up with smoother, brighter, and more youthful-looking eyes.
Unlike traditional eye creams or serums, these patches create an occlusive barrier, meaning they lock in moisture and help active ingredients penetrate deeper into the skin. This delivery system is what sets them apart, making them a favorite for those seeking quick, visible results without the hassle of a multi-step routine.

The Science Behind Overnight Anti-Wrinkle Eye Patches
To understand how these patches work, we need to talk about their ingredients and delivery mechanism. Most high-quality overnight eye patches are formulated with a blend of hydrating, firming, and brightening ingredients. Here’s a breakdown of the heavy hitters you’ll often find:
- Hyaluronic Acid: A hydration superstar, hyaluronic acid can hold up to 1,000 times its weight in water. It plumps the skin, reducing the appearance of fine lines and giving the under-eye area a smoother look.
- Retinol: A derivative of vitamin A, retinol is a gold-standard ingredient for anti-aging. It boosts cell turnover and collagen production, helping to soften wrinkles over time.
- Peptides: These small protein fragments signal the skin to produce more collagen and elastin, improving firmness and elasticity.
- Collagen: While topical collagen can’t penetrate deeply enough to rebuild the skin’s structure, it acts as a humectant, drawing moisture to the surface for a temporary plumping effect.
- Caffeine: Often included to reduce puffiness, caffeine constricts blood vessels and minimizes under-eye bags.
- Niacinamide: This multitasking ingredient brightens dark circles, evens skin tone, and strengthens the skin barrier.
The occlusive nature of the patches enhances these ingredients’ effectiveness. By creating a barrier, the patches prevent moisture loss and allow the active ingredients to stay in contact with the skin longer, increasing absorption. Some patches also use micro-needle technology, where tiny, dissolvable needles deliver ingredients deeper into the skin for enhanced results.
Do Overnight Anti-Wrinkle Eye Patches Really Work?

The million-dollar question: do these patches deliver on their promises? The answer depends on your expectations and the product’s quality. Let’s break it down by the common claims.
Reducing Fine Lines and Wrinkles
Overnight eye patches can temporarily smooth fine lines, thanks to their hydrating ingredients and occlusive design. Hyaluronic acid and collagen provide an immediate plumping effect, making wrinkles less noticeable. However, these results are often short-lived—think hours, not days. For long-term wrinkle reduction, look for patches with retinol or peptides, which stimulate collagen production over time. Consistent use (several times a week for a month or more) is key to seeing lasting improvements.
Minimizing Puffiness
If under-eye bags are your concern, patches with caffeine or cooling ingredients like aloe vera can make a noticeable difference. Caffeine constricts blood vessels, reducing swelling, while the cooling sensation of gel-based patches soothes inflammation. I’ve found that patches work best for puffiness caused by fluid retention (like after a salty meal or a late night) rather than genetic or structural under-eye bags, which may require professional treatments.
Brightening Dark Circles
Dark circles are tricky. If they’re caused by pigmentation, patches with niacinamide or vitamin C can help brighten the area over time. However, if your dark circles are due to thinning skin or shadows from hollows, topical treatments like patches can only do so much. In my experience, the brightening effect is subtle and more effective as a preventative measure than a cure.
Overall Efficacy
In my testing, high-quality overnight anti-wrinkle eye patches deliver visible results, especially for hydration and puffiness. The immediate plumping and smoothing effects are satisfying, particularly for special occasions or when you need to look refreshed fast. However, they’re not a replacement for a consistent skincare routine or professional treatments like fillers or laser therapy for deeper wrinkles or structural issues.

How to Choose the Best Overnight Anti-Wrinkle Eye Patches
Not all eye patches are created equal. With countless options flooding the market, here’s how to pick ones that actually work:
- Check the Ingredient List: Look for proven ingredients like hyaluronic acid, retinol, peptides, or niacinamide. Avoid patches with fragrances or alcohol, which can irritate the delicate under-eye area.
- Consider Your Skin Type: If you have sensitive skin, opt for gentle, fragrance-free formulas. For oily skin, choose gel-based patches that won’t clog pores.
- Read Reviews: Real user feedback can reveal how patches perform over time. Look for reviews from people with similar skin concerns.
- Brand Reputation: Stick to brands with a track record of quality and transparency. Reputable companies often provide clinical studies or dermatologist endorsements.
- Price vs. Value: High-end patches can cost $50 or more for a month’s supply, while budget options start at $10. Expensive doesn’t always mean better—focus on ingredients and efficacy.

How to Use Overnight Anti-Wrinkle Eye Patches Like a Pro
To get the most out of your eye patches, application matters. Here’s my step-by-step guide:
- Cleanse and Prep: Start with a clean, dry face. Gently cleanse the under-eye area to remove makeup, oil, or debris.
- Apply Carefully: Place the patches about 1-2 mm below your lower lash line, ensuring they sit flat against the skin. Avoid getting too close to the eyes to prevent irritation.
- Leave Them On: Most patches are designed for 6-8 hours of wear, making them ideal for overnight use. If you’re sensitive to adhesives, try a 20-30 minute session first.
- Remove and Follow Up: Gently peel off the patches in the morning and massage any remaining serum into the skin. Follow with your regular eye cream and sunscreen.
- Store Properly: Keep patches in a cool, dry place to maintain their potency. Some brands recommend refrigerating them for an extra cooling effect.
Pro tip: Use patches 2-3 times a week for consistent results. Overusing them can lead to irritation, especially if they contain potent actives like retinol.

Potential Downsides and Limitations
No product is perfect, and overnight anti-wrinkle eye patches have their drawbacks:
- Temporary Results: The plumping and smoothing effects often fade within hours unless you’re using patches with long-term actives like retinol.
- Irritation Risk: Adhesives or potent ingredients can cause redness or sensitivity, especially for those with delicate skin.
- Cost: Regular use can get pricey, especially for premium brands.
- Not a Cure-All: Patches can’t address deep wrinkles, structural under-eye bags, or severe dark circles caused by genetics or thinning skin.
If you experience irritation or don’t see results after a few weeks, it might be time to consult a dermatologist for personalized advice.
